8 Quick Balcony Garden Upgrades for Small Apartments: Maximizing Space & Greenery on a Budget

My balcony used to be an absolute disaster zone. Honestly, it was just a tiny, sad-looking cement slab outside my slide door where I tossed broken mops, empty shipping boxes, and wet laundry.

I’d stand out there in the mornings with my mug, scrolling through Pinterest and wishing I had one of those dream garden nooks. Then I’d look up outdoor furniture prices, see $400 for a single chair, and immediately close my phone.

Turns out, you don’t need deep pockets or a massive backyard to fix an awkward outdoor slab. Here are 8 practical balcony garden upgrades that helped me clear up space and turn my cramped balcony into a spot where I actually love hanging out.

1. Stop Using the Floor for Everything

When I started out, I made the classic rookie mistake. I bought three huge clay pots and dropped them right on the floor. Boom half my standing space vanished, and I kept bashing my toes on the rims every time I opened the door.

If floor space is tight, stop treating it like your only option. Smart balcony garden upgrades focus on using your walls and railings instead.

  • Slap a pallet on the wall: Grab a free shipping pallet from behind a grocery store or buy a cheap trellis. Lean it against the wall and clamp your small pots onto the wooden slats.
  • Over-rail planters: Hanging boxes on the outside edge of your balcony rail leaves 100% of your actual walking path open.
  • The hanging shoe-pouch trick: Grab a cheap $10 cloth organizer. Nail or hook it to an empty wall, scoop soil into the pockets, and drop in herbs like basil, mint, and cilantro. Instant green wall in twenty minutes flat.
